"A majority of consumers have been worrying about the format situation. Some manufacturers manufacture players only for Blu-ray. And others make players only for HD DVD. And some Hollywood studios make DVDs only in one format. So this is a very unhealthy situation for the whole industry as well as consumers. And we were very concerned. This is not only a problem for the DVD industry, but it could also affect the high definition television industry as well. So we felt our approach of having a single player which can play both formats …it's just like the conventional DVD."
LG plans to begin shipping the Super Multi Blue player next month. One drawback…the 12 hundred dollar price tag. Lee says that should eventually come down as manufacturing ramps up.
